Site work and paving for a civil project in Cochrane, Alberta. Completed plans call for site work for a road / highway; and bridge / tunnel.
Work consists of (1) expanding Highway 1A to 4 lanes (2 lanes in each direction) from east of Big Hill Creek to west of Highway 22; (2) eliminating the existing Highway 1A traffic signal on Highway 22; (3) 2 new bridges over Big Hill Creek with removal of the existing bridge; (4) replacing the Highway 22 Canadian Pacific Railway overpass to accommodate the new interchange ramps; (5) new overpass to carry Highway 22 over Highway 1A; and (6) new interchange ramps to connect the 2 highways. Project cost is estimated to be between $75 to $85 million. *Project inquiries can be directed to Hwy1A22@islengineering.com Documents can be obtained from https://vendor.purchasingconnection.ca
